Open is Best: Open communication in a calm, straightforward and non-judgemental way is best. If your job is the only source of income for the family then this is very important. You know him best; if you are unable to communicate in this manner with him seek professional help with a counselor to find better ways to communicate.

caregiving: Recommend this be approached in a non-judgmental manner. It may be a good opportunity for problem solving. Are there some things your spouse depends on you for that he can do for himself? Do you need the help of others to provide him care? Can loved ones or relatives help or is it time to augment with a professional caregiver who is salaried. Is respite care available.?
